These blends look simple, but the joy of a synergy is just that: The oils work in tandem to provide therapeutic value. The whole is greater than the sum of its parts.

Lemongrass essential oil is known as a powerful anti-fungal and skin astringent. It is my Springtime go-to for warding off insects, mold, and fungus caused by high humidity. The scent is strong: Adjust the amount of drops as you prefer, adding them slowly to the maximum noted. You may find you can do more with less. In these recipes, the percentage of oils to carrier is 5-6 percent; decrease amounts for a lighter aroma.

For the massage blend, combine essential oils with 1 oz. carrier oil (I like Argan Oil) in a glass bottle. Gently roll the bottle between your palms to warm and blend.

For the aromatic mists, add to distilled water in a 1 oz. glass spray bottle. Avoid spraying near your face.
